"John McCrone" wrote: >I'm looking for advice on spawning blue rams..... Too cool--26 degrees Centigrades translates into 78.8 degrees Fahrenheit. Rams come from shallow water (I think less than a foot deep) that's in the sun all day (savanah environment). They love temperatures of 85 to 90 degrees F. Their colors are much brighter in the higher temperature ranges and they'll breed frequently.
